Value readout
Where each school has the edge
Linn-Benton Community College costs $1,005 more per year than Clatsop Community College ($11,553 vs $10,548). Linn-Benton Community College graduates report $1,886 higher median earnings after ten years ($41,363 vs $39,477). On EduGradify's model that puts Clatsop Community College ahead on projected ROI (9.36 vs 8.95, exceptional investment).
The more affordable option (Clatsop Community College) also posts the better return, making it the lower-risk pick on cost alone. On admissions, neither school reports a standard acceptance rate in the current federal data, so this matchup should lean on price, outcomes and fit instead.
